Formula
acre = ha × 2.4710538147
Example
Example: convert 200 hectares to acres.
200 ha = 494.21076293 acre
Conversion table
| hectares (ha) | acres (acre) |
|---|---|
| 1 ha | 2.47105381 acre |
| 2 ha | 4.94210763 acre |
| 5 ha | 12.35526907 acre |
| 10 ha | 24.71053815 acre |
| 20 ha | 49.42107629 acre |
| 50 ha | 123.55269073 acre |
| 100 ha | 247.10538147 acre |

How to convert hectares to acres
- Start with the value in hectares (ha).
- Multiply it by 2.4710538147.
- The result is the measurement in acres (acre).
Example: 200 ha → 494.21076293 acre

How many acres is 1 hectare?
1 hectare equals 2.47105381 acres.
How many hectares is 1 acre?
1 acre equals 0.40468564224 hectares.
